The Scene – Sacred ground to misty-eyed natives, this Buckhead landmark is a midday carnival of suits, ladies in tennis outfits and a cheerfully noisy staff in floppy baker's hats. The action centers on a well-stocked pastry case and a busy sandwich counter. Better known as a takeout place, some seating is available next door in the makeshift espresso bar. – – The Food – Henri's doubles as a yellow sponge cake bakery and lunchtime takeout source. The bakery case is full of old-fashioned goodies: gingerbread men, eclairs, shortbread cookies and locally renowned cheese…
